The Jays appear to be trading away some future pieces to get R.A. Dickey. Odds are that either JP Arencibia or Travis d'Arnaud would be moved sometime within the year, and I'm reasonably pleased with Arencibia's bat for a catcher and his gradually improving defense. I guess the Jay's front office might have doubts on d'Arnaud's ability to bounce back from his injury mid last season.

I am not that familiar with the Jays prospects but I feel that they are making a mistake given up youth for a 36-year old knuckleballer with only 2 good years under his belt. Granted, he won the Cy Young award last year with a bad Mets team, but I just don't see him coming close to repeating that again.
